Enhanced Capabilities of Arlo Pro 2
Arlo Pro 2: Upgraded Features for Peace of Mind
Welcome to the series where we explore the enhancements in home security technology! When considering the Arlo Pro 2, you'll find a number of upgraded features designed to offer more comprehensive security for your home.
One key feature that stands out is the improved video quality. The Arlo Pro 2 offers more than a simple upgrade; it serves 1080p HD video footage compared to its predecessor's 720p. This improvement ensures that your recorded motion events are clearer and more detailed, which could be crucial in identifying potential threats.
Another substantial enhancement is the introduction of Activity Zones. This feature permits users to highlight specific areas they want the camera to focus on. By doing so, the Arlo Pro 2 provides optimized alerts, helping to reduce false notifications and making sure that the user is alerted to the activities that truly matter.
The inclusion of the Continuous Video Recording (CVR) feature, albeit requiring a subscription, is a notable advancement for those who prefer around-the-clock monitoring. Unlike between the Arlo Pro, which relies primarily on triggered events, the Pro 2 shifts toward a 24/7 recording capability with the right plan.
For those weighing the pros and cons of battery versus direct power, the Arlo Pro 2 offers flexibility. While this security camera still functions efficiently with battery power, the option to have the camera plugged in affords users access to full capabilities, including the CVR and Activity Zones.
The Arlo Pro 2's enhanced night vision is another compelling feature that shouldn't be overlooked. Enhanced technology means brighter and clearer night footage, which ensures that security doesn't falter when the sun goes down.
With the Arlo smart base station, users are also able to enjoy local storage options, a considerable advantage for those who may not wish to subscribe to cloud storage, although cloud options remain available for offsite data backup.

Comparing Arlo Pro and Arlo Pro 2
Distinguishing Features and Benefits
When comparing the Arlo Pro and Arlo Pro 2 cameras, several factors illuminate why a homeowner might choose one over the other. Understanding these differences can help you make an informed decision when picking the best security camera for your needs.
Video Quality and Resolution
In terms of video capabilities, the Arlo Pro 2 offers a notable enhancement with 1080p resolution compared to the 720p offered by the Arlo Pro. This provides crisper, clearer footage, making it easier to identify finer details in your security footage.
Battery Life and Power Options
Both cameras are designed with rechargeable batteries, but the Arlo Pro 2 takes it a step further by allowing you to keep the camera plugged in for increased reliability and continuous power—an option that some users prefer for greater peace of mind. While both systems offer solid battery life, Arlo Pro 2’s capability for hardwiring adds to the convenience.
Advanced Motion Detection
Motion detection is at the heart of any security system, and with these smart cameras, you have robust options. The Arlo Pro 2 features upgraded functionality, such as activity zones, which allows you to highlight specific areas for detection, reducing the number of alerts triggered by non-critical movements.
Storage Options and Local Storage
Both Arlo cameras support cloud storage options that provide access to your video footage from anywhere. However, the Arlo Pro 2 gives users the added benefit of accessing local storage options by connecting a USB device to the base station, offering a layer of privacy and reduced dependence on subscription models.
